#014c9b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#014c9b is composed of 0.4% red, 29.8%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.4% cyan, 51%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 210.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 30.6%. #014c9b color hex could be obtained by blending #0298ff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#014c9b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#014c9b has RGB values of R:1, G:76,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 85147.

Shades and Tints of #014c9b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000913 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#014c9b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494e53 is the less saturated color, while #014c9b is the most saturated one.
